Hi fellas,
did anyone of you tried the new rules from http://www.heroheim.com/?

Seems a little bit more balanced than the original mordheim stuff. Although the first negative point is the missing difference between clubs, axes and swords. Also I'm missing the the knocked down/stunned rules as an essential point of the mordheim skirmish game.

- Merging club, axe, sword is controversial but appeals to WHFB players.
- KD/ S is gone and we don't miss it at all. It makes shooting a more integral (and less random) part of the game.
- Also, consider the walls of text and rules needed for KD/S which is now gone.
- It will be my point that if GW had introduced W2 from the start, and someone else came along and wanted to introduce the walls of text for KD/S, people would laugh.

But of course I may be wrong :-)

Hi thanks for your interest in Coreheim and Heroheim.

BOTH projects are being carried forward.
Each is continually updated but Coreheim is unlikely to see any large-scale changes. - More like balance adjustments and clarifications.

Heroheim is still a sort of beta. Some players play it and say that its smooth and fun but there is still much to be worked out.

As for many warbands, well...... The more warbands you do, the harder they are to balance.
